I did so too :-) See my repository in gedasymbols. ( http://www.gedasymbols.org/user/kai_martin_knaak/ ) Like you, I noticed that attributes fail to be promoted when initializing a new page. My workaround is to delete the automatically loaded title block and reinsert it like an ordinary symbol from the library. I filed a bug report on this (http://shortlink.co.uk/toh). Something that works though, is to unlock the attributes but not the graphics. Just drag a lasso that encloses the attributes but not all of the graphics and press [SHIFT-E][L]. That way, the page info can be edited while the large box is still immune to mouse clicks. > Why is that so?
